Existing buildings are covered under the FBC-E under Chapters 5,6, and 7 for Level One, Two and Three Alterations under the section for ENERGY CONSERVATION. The minimum requirements for energy conservation is referred to Chapter 13 ( Energy Efficiency ) of the Florida Building Code in each case. It is interesting to note that EXISTING BUILDINGS ARE EXEMPT from Chapter 13 requirements unless the building meets the requirements for classification as a RENOVATED BUILDING, A CHANGE IN OCCUPANCY, OR A PREVIOUSLY UNCONDITIONED BUILDING to which comfort conditioning is added. ...F.C. 13-101.5 IMHO it appears that section 13-101.6 for thermal efficiency standards does NOT apply for the majority of partial replacement of components of a mechanical system. The Code as currently written appears to exempt the exception requirements found under 13-101.6 and would be better relocated as an exception under 13-101.5 EXEMPT BUILDINGS. What say you all? Bob Antol rantol at co.volusia.fl.us >>> Steve Roland <steven_t05 at hotmail.com> 2/15/2010 8:44:19 AM >>> Actually the Florida Building Code does address systems that are not a complete change out. It is found in chapter 13-101.6. Though only one part of the system is replaced the whole system must be matched. This can be accomplished by one of four means, 1. ARI (AHRI) data 2. Accredited laboratory (example ARL labs) 3. Mnufacturer's letter 4. Letter from registered P.E. State of Florida. I hope this helps. Steve
